Monthly Airbnb Revenue Variations & Income Potential in Nicolosi (2025)
Understanding the monthly revenue variations for Airbnb listings in Nicolosi is key to maximizing your short term rental income potential. Seasonality significantly impacts earnings. Our analysis, based on data from the past 12 months, shows that the peak revenue month for STRs in Nicolosi is typically August, while January often presents the lowest earnings, highlighting opportunities for strategic pricing adjustments during shoulder and low seasons. Explore the typical Airbnb income in Nicolosi across different performance tiers: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ve $2,144+ monthly, often utilizing dynamic pricing and superior guest experiences.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) earn $1,409 or more, indicating effective management and desirable locations/amenities.
- Typical properties (Median) generate around $704 per month, representing the average market performance.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) see earnings around $327, often with potential for optimization.

Nicolosi Airbnb Occupancy Rate Trends (2025)
Maximize your bookings by understanding the Nicolosi STR occupancy trends. Seasonal demand shifts significantly influence how often properties are booked. Typically, Augustsees the highest demand (peak season occupancy), while January experiences the lowest (low season). Effective strategies, like adjusting minimum stays or offering promotions, can boost occupancy during slower periods. Here's how different property tiers perform in Nicolosi: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ve 65%+ occupancy, indicating high desirability and potentially optimized availability.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) maintain 46% or higher occupancy, suggesting good market fit and guest satisfaction.
- Typical properties (Median) have an occupancy rate around 22%.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) average 11% occupancy, potentially facing higher vacancy.

Airbnb Seasonality Analysis & Trends in Nicolosi (2025)
Peak Season (August, May, April)
- Revenue averages $1,574 per month
- Occupancy rates average 38.5%
- Daily rates average $101
Shoulder Season
- Revenue averages $1,021 per month
- Occupancy maintains around 29.0%
- Daily rates hold near $103
Low Season (January, February, November)
- Revenue drops to average $690 per month
- Occupancy decreases to average 24.8%
- Daily rates adjust to average $105
Seasonality Insights for Nicolosi
- The Airbnb seasonality in Nicolosi sh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it's also insightful to look at the extremes:
- During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Nicolosi's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ues capable of climbing to $1,768, occupancy reaching a high of 44.7%, and ADRs peaking at $110.
- Conversely, the slowest single month of the year, typically falling within the low season, marks the market's lowest point. In this month, revenue might dip to $679, occupancy could drop to 23.1%, and ADRs may adjust down to $98.

Best Areas for Airbnb Investment in Nicolosi (2025)
Exploring the top neighborhoods for short-term rentals in Nicolosi? This section highlights key areas, outlining why they are attractive for hosts and guests, along with notable local attractions. Consider these locations based on your target guest profile and investment strategy.
Neighborhood / Area | Why Host Here? (Target Guests & Appeal) | Key Attractions & Landmarks |
---|---|---|
Etna Park Area | A breathtaking location near Mount Etna, attracting nature lovers and adventure seekers. Ideal for hiking and exploring the unique landscapes of the volcano. | Mount Etna, Etna Park, Hiking trails, Vineyards, Catania's local cuisine |
Historic Center of Nicolosi | Charming town with historical significance and traditional Sicilian architecture. Close to local shops and restaurants, perfect for cultural tourism. | Church of the Madonna della Sciara, Piazza Vittorio Emanuele, Local eateries, Historic buildings, Cultural events |
Linguaglossa | Another gateway to Mount Etna, this area offers stunning views, wine tasting, and a tranquil village atmosphere. Attracts tourists seeking a peaceful retreat in nature. | Mount Etna cable cars, Wine tasting tours, Natural parks, Scenic views, Local festivals |
Nicolosi's Vineyards | Home to beautiful vineyards producing excellent Sicilian wine, this area attracts wine lovers and tourists interested in local agritourism. | Vineyard tours, Wine tasting experiences, Agritourism, Scenic landscapes, Local restaurants |
Catania Coast | A short drive from Nicolosi, this coastal area offers beautiful beaches and seaside activities, appealing to those looking for a summer getaway. | San Giovanni Li Cuti Beach, La Playa di Catania, Water sports, Seaside restaurants, Nightlife |
Zafferana Etnea | A picturesque town on the slopes of Mount Etna, known for its honey production and stunning views. Popular for both outdoor activities and culinary experiences. | Honey farms, Scenic hiking trails, Local food festivals, Amazing viewpoints, Cultural heritage |
Acireale | Renowned for its Baroque architecture and beautiful coastal scenery. Attracts visitors interested in art, culture, and relaxation by the sea. | Acireale Cathedral, Piazza del Duomo, Coastal promenade, Historic theaters, Natural thermal spas |
Syracuse (Siracusa) | A bit further away, but a historically rich city with ancient ruins and beautiful coastlines. A must-see for tourists visiting Sicily. | Ortygia Island, Archaeological Park, Temple of Apollo, Piazza Archimede, Fountain of Arethusa |

Nicolosi ST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)
Average Booking Lead Time by Month
Booking Lead Time Insights for Nicolosi
- The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Nicolosi is 52 days.
- Guests book furthest in advance for stays during August (average 74 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
- The shortest booking windows occur for stays in December (average 32 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
- Seasonally, Summer (61 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Winter (36 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.

Nicolosi Airbnb Guest Demographics & Profile Analysis (2025)
Guest Profile Summary for Nicolosi
- The typical guest profile for Airbnb in Nicolosi consists of predominantly international visitors (86%), with top international origins including Italy, typically belonging to the Post-2000s (Gen Z/Alpha) group (50%), primarily speaking English or French.
- Domestic travelers account for 14.3% of guests.
- Key international markets include France (27.9%) and Italy (14.3%).
- Top languages spoken are English (38.8%) followed by French (18.9%).
- A significant demographic segment is the Post-2000s (Gen Z/Alpha) group, representing 50% of guests.
